Letter F. I. de Sol No. 164 Sch/H 16th February, 1938. Mr. H.V. Tewson, LONDON. Dear Comrade Tewson, I am sorry that, owing to rather a long absence from the office, I am only now able to acknowledge receipt of your two letters of the 1st and 7th February . With reference to your letter of the 1st February, I would like to point out that I did not say that all of the goods distributed in Spain were labelled, but that most of them were. With regard to the proposals you make as to labelling of the goods, I will go into the technical possibilities of this and see what can be done. I am very glad to have Mrs. Adams de Puertas' notes about the relief work in Spain, which are of course of great interest to us, and for which we are much obliged. Yours sincerely, W. Schevenels, General Secretary: 292/946/30/200
